自主导航的未来:探索智能高尔夫球车
self-driving-golf-cartBe Driven 🚘项目地址:https://gitcode.com/gh_mirrors/se/self-driving-golf-cart
在人工智能和自动驾驶领域,一个令人瞩目的开源项目悄然绽放——自驾驶高尔夫球车。该项目由热情的开发者Neil Nie与Michael Meng共同打造,它不仅是技术爱好者的实验场,也是深度学习和机器人研究的一个鲜活例子。尽管目前该仓库不再维护,其开源精神和创新实践仍然值得我们深入探讨。
项目介绍
这是一套基于开源理念构建的自驾驶平台,专为快速原型设计、深度学习应用以及机器人学研究而生。项目以一辆改装的电动高尔夫球车为基础,目标直指L4级别的自动驾驶能力,锁定于特定地理围栏区域内的自主行驶。通过集成先进的感知模块与复杂的决策系统,它成为了一个教学与研发的理想工具。
技术剖析
这个项目凝聚了多个关键技术模块:
- 端到端转向控制(行为克隆):利用深度学习模拟人类驾驶员的行为。
- 语义分割:精确识别道路、行人和其他障碍物。
- 对象检测:确保车辆能够准确识别周围的车辆和物体。
- 线控驱动(DBW):实现车辆的电子化操控。
- CARLA仿真环境整合:提供安全的虚拟测试场所。
- ZED立体视觉系统:提供高精度的实时环境理解。
- RTAB-Map建图与定位:确保精确定位和地图构建。
- ROS导航堆栈:路径规划和自动导航的核心。
应用场景展望
想象一下,这样的技术不仅限于娱乐场所的趣味体验。它可以应用于园区的无人配送服务,或是高级住宅区的安全巡逻,甚至作为紧急物资运输的灵活工具。在教育领域,这个项目提供了完美的案例,让学生们亲身体验从理论到实践的飞跃,尤其是在自动驾驶汽车的设计与编程上。
项目亮点
- 全面性:覆盖自动驾驶的关键技术栈,适合多角度研究。
- 教育友好:详尽文档和在线资源便于学术与个人成长。
- 开源文化:虽然不再更新,但仍贡献了一座宝贵的代码宝库。
- 实际操作性强:即使硬件限制,也能通过仿真或部分功能体验其魅力。
尽管官方支持已经终止,但其技术价值和启发性依然不减。对于那些对自动驾驶充满好奇,希望深入了解和实践的开发者和研究者而言,这一项目依然是一个绝佳起点。通过探索这个项目,你将不仅仅是驶向未来的乘客,更是推动技术进步的驾驶者。让我们一同启程,向着自驾驶的星辰大海进发。🚀
self-driving-golf-cartBe Driven 🚘项目地址:https://gitcode.com/gh_mirrors/se/self-driving-golf-cart